Description: # Background The ReAD-StuD project performs a quantitative analysis and deduplication of registered studies that were performed in Germany. This study had the aim to join all German trials from clinicaltrials.gov (via AACT), the International Trials Registry Platform (ICTRP) and the German Clinical Trials Register (DRKS). # Data Data from the respective platforms was downloaded at the beginning of 2021. The resulting data is available as a csv-file in all_trials_de.csv. Since the table is too large to browse it on OSF, we have created a random sample of 1000 trials from that table which is in all_trials_de_sample1000.csv. This table can be produced using the supplied scripts. # Scripts To reproduce all_trials_de.csv and the plots from our corresponding article, the four scripts should be executed in order. 1 - Data: Load the data files from AACT, ICTRP and DRKS and create data frames for the individual data bases 2 - Random Forest: Train a Random Forest model for identifying duplicates between the data bases 3 - Join: Join the three data frames using primary IDs and the Random Forest model to create all_trials_de.csv 4 - Plots: Plots for our corresponding paper which illustrate overlaps between data bases, pre-registration trends and the number of trials in all data bases over time
